Shawn Johnson Video Causes B.S. “Controversy”

We already mentioned it as a throwaway link in yesterday’s Speed Read, because it was a funny parody of the strange treatment of thoroughbreds in the horse racing industry but nothing meriting more than one line in a morning post, but in case you missed it THE ONION put together an obviously, ludicrously fake piece about Shawn Johnson being euthanized after breaking a kneecap. For whatever reason, be it her “America’s Sweetheart” status, her young age, or the fact that people in her native Iowa have nothing better to do than overreact about anything involving local celebrities,  the DES MOINES REGISTER decided to ask people close to her about the video. Which was satire, people. Surprise, surprise, mock outrage ensues:

In an e-mail, Johnson’s publicist Susan Madore said, “At this time there will be no comment from Shawn or her parents about the video.”

[…] Geena Pilcher, a former gym mate of Shawn Johnson and a soon-to-be-junior at Johnston High School, was not amused by the video.

“It’s sort of rude; it’s just over the top,” said Pilcher, who competed in gymnastics with Johnson for five years.
